Sha256: bbf86e2ee8a0ce495191642b591769b8973cbeed3d979be1390c114832b6805c

Contents?: true

Size: 249 Bytes

Versions: 25

Compression:

Stored size: 249 Bytes

Contents

# 
# HTML helpers
# 
[MongoMapper::EmbeddedDocument::InstanceMethods, MongoMapper::Document::InstanceMethods].each do |aclass|
  aclass.class_eval do
    def dom_id
      new_record? ? "new_#{self.class.name.underscore}" : to_param
    end
  end
end

Version data entries

25 entries across 25 versions & 2 rubygems

Version Path
crystal-ext-0.0.3 lib/mongo_mapper_ext/view_helpers.rb
crystal-ext-0.0.2 lib/mongo_mapper_ext/view_helpers.rb
crystal-ext-0.0.1 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.29 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.28 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.27 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.25 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.24 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.23 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.22 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.21 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.20 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.19 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.18 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.17 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.16 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.15 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.14 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.13 lib/mongo_mapper_ext/view_helpers.rb
rails-ext-0.3.12 lib/mongo_mapper_ext/view_helpers.rb